About This Item
London: Maclehose Press, 2019. First Edition. Octavo. Millennium Series. Limited to 500 copies signed by the author and translator George Goulding. The present copy is #497. 357 (7) pp., The author takes us on a thrilling ride that scales the heights of Everest and plunges to the depths of Russia's criminal underworld. In a climax of shattering violence, Lisbeth Salander once again will face her nemesis. For the girl with the dragon tattoo, the personal is always political-and ultimately deadly. A fine copy bound in black cloth, spine lettering gilt, all edges black, in a fine red pictorial dust jacket lettered in red and white.
